PRAYER: Writ Petition filed under Article 226 of the Constitution of India to issue a Writ of Mandamus directing the respondents to consider the representation of the petitioners dated 28.12.2022 and furnish the copy of the free house site patta already issued by the 2nd respondent in Plot Nos.48 and 156 situated at Samathuvapuram, MGR Colony, Tharamangalam Village, Omalur Taluk, Salem District to the petitioners. ORDER
With the consent of both the parties, this Writ Petition is taken up for final disposal at the admission stage itself.
2. The petitioners have filed this writ petition seeking a direction to the respondents to consider their individual representations dated 28.12.2022 and furnish the copies of free house site patta already issued by the 2nd respondent in Plot Nos.48 and 156 situated at Samathuvapuram, MGR Colony, Tharamangalam Village, Omalur Taluk, Salem District to the petitioners.
3. It is needless to point out that whenever representations of this nature are made to a Statutory Authority, there is a duty cast upon him to consider the same on their own merits and pass appropriate orders in one way or other, instead of keeping the same pending indefinitely. As such, non-consideration of the representations by the Statutory Authority would amount to dereliction of duty and hence, this Court will be justified in invoking its extraordinary powers under Article 226 of Constitution of India and direct him to consider the same within a stipulated time. 2/4
4. In the light of the above observations, there shall be a direction to the second respondent herein to consider the petitioners' individual representations dated 28.12.2022 on their own merits and pass appropriate orders in accordance with law, after giving due opportunity to the petitioners as well as all other persons who may be interested in the subject property, within a period of twelve we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order. It is made clear that this Court has not expressed any of its views with regard to the merits of the claim of the petitioners and that it is open to the concerned respondent to consider the same on its own merits.
5. With the above direction, the Writ Petition stands disposed of. No costs.
